- Registry v3 gates this release. No event schema ships without a registered, versioned entry.
- Compatibility mode set to backward-only; breaking changes need an explicit override record.
- Two producers (Cartwheel, Lampkey) still publish unregistered payloads. Deadline: freeze minus three days, or they're pulled from the train.
- Release manager should verify the registry diff report in the cut checklist; don't cut on a red diff.
- Overrides and disputes need sign-off from the registry owner, named below.

named custodian: Brivan Eliath Quenox Frador

## Configuration

Since the Pellgrove user module was extracted from the monolith into user-svc, config lives in `.env.usersvc`, not the legacy settings blob. Set USER_SVC_PORT and USER_SVC_DB_URL first; the service refuses to boot without both. Legacy keys prefixed MONO_USER_ are ignored and can be deleted. The service also needs the inter-service credential it uses to call back into the monolith during the transition. Add that line next:

secret setting of tawif-tajop: COURIER_KEY13=819c65d82d2bd

# Break-Glass: Catalog Cache Invalidation

Scope: the Pinrow product catalog at Veldstone Retail. If stale prices persist after a purge and the Hollowmere invalidation queue is wedged, use break-glass to flush the edge tier directly. Contractors: get verbal sign-off from the catalog lead first. Steps: open the Hollowmere admin shell, select emergency-flush, confirm the tenant, and run it once — repeated flushes thrash the origin. Access is logged and expires after 20 minutes. Unseal the admin shell with the passphrase below.

recovery phrase for kahop-tajog: istix-casvan

# Stormfan fan-out service — contractor notes
# This file configures how Stormfan pushes severe-weather alerts from the
# Calder Basin feed to subscriber channels. Keep FANOUT_BATCH at 200 and
# RETRY_BACKOFF_MS at 1500 unless told otherwise by the alerts lead.
# Never commit this file. The line right after this comment block must set
# the publisher credential.

sealed setting: ARCHIVE_KEY3=8d0